FAQs
What is the maximum range of the VTech VM4263 monitor?
The monitor has an advertised range of up to 300 meters (approximately 1000 feet) in open field conditions. This range can be affected by walls and other obstructions.
Can I view the monitor feed on my smartphone?
No, the VTech VM4263 is a dedicated video baby monitor system and does not connect to Wi-Fi or smartphone apps. All viewing is done on the included parent unit.
How long does the battery on the parent unit last?
The rechargeable battery in the parent unit provides up to 19 hours of video streaming on a full charge.
Does the camera have night vision?
Yes, the camera features automatic infrared night vision, which provides a clear black-and-white video feed in low-light conditions.
Can I play lullabies through the monitor?
Yes, the monitor includes two built-in calming melodies and two soft ambient sounds that can be played to soothe your baby.
How do I adjust the night light on the baby unit?
The night light on the baby unit features adaptive brightness and can be controlled by touching the light icon on the parent unit to adjust its colour and brightness.
Is the camera mountable?
Yes, the baby unit can be placed on a flat surface or wall-mounted using the included mounting hardware for optimal positioning.
Troubleshooting
No video or audio feed
Ensure both the baby unit and parent unit are powered on and charged. Check that they are within range and try re-pairing the units according to the manual. Verify that the baby unit is plugged into a working power outlet.
Poor video quality or static
Minimize interference by moving the units away from other electronic devices like microwaves or Wi-Fi routers. Ensure the camera lens is clean. Check if the units are within the optimal operating range.
Parent unit not charging
Check the AC adapter connection to both the parent unit and the power outlet. Try a different power outlet. Ensure the charging contacts on the parent unit are clean.
Temperature reading seems inaccurate
Ensure the baby unit is not placed near direct heat sources or drafts. Allow the unit some time to acclimate to the room's temperature after initial setup.
Sound activated soothing not working
Verify that the sound activated soothing feature is enabled in the parent unit's settings. Ensure the volume sensitivity is set appropriately.

Setup, Compatibility & Care
Setup:
Power Connection: Connect the AC adapter to the baby unit (camera) and plug it into a power outlet. Connect the AC adapter to the parent unit and plug it into a power outlet. Allow the parent unit to charge fully before first use.
Pairing: The parent unit and baby unit are typically pre-paired. If they lose connection, follow the on-screen prompts or refer to the manual for re-pairing instructions.
Placement: Position the baby unit on a flat surface or use the included wall-mounting hardware to attach it to a wall, ensuring it has a clear line of sight to the crib.
Compatibility:
This system is designed to work with its dedicated VTech parent unit. It is not compatible with Wi-Fi networks or smartphone apps.
Ensure the parent unit and baby unit are within the specified range (up to 300m) for optimal performance.
Care:
Cleaning: Wipe the parent unit and baby unit with a soft, damp cloth. Do not use abrasive cleaners or solvents.
Battery: Recharge the parent unit's battery regularly. For long-term storage, ensure the battery is partially charged.
Lens: Gently clean the camera lens with a microfiber cloth to maintain image clarity.
